CellCounting-Lite 3D Luminescent Cell Viability Assay, SKU: DD1102

CellCounting-Lite 3D (CCL3D) is a cell viability assay that detects the amount of ATP released by micro-tissue cell clump, sphenoid or organoids under 3D cell culture conditions.

 

Product Overview

CellCounting-Lite 3D (CCL3D) is a cell viability assay based on a luciferase system. This reagent contains high-purity luciferin, thermostable luciferase, and optimized reaction reagents, resulting in enhanced lysis capabilities and making it more suitable for micro-tissue cell clump samples under 3D cell culture conditions.

 

Adding this product to cell cultures causes cell clumps to lyse and release ATP, resulting in the reaction shown in Figure 1 and emitting a stable light signal. Within a certain range, the luminescence intensity is directly proportional to the ATP content (i.e., the number of viable cells). Therefore, this product can be used for the quantitative detection of viable cell counts.
